A person’s bodily health level can even affect the number of steps taken during a marathon. A more fit person might have a longer stride size and a higher step rate, resulting in fewer steps taken to cover the same distance. The variety of steps in a mile whereas walking can even range relying on various components. On average, a person takes between 2,000 and a pair of,500 steps to stroll a mile. However, this number can range relying on components corresponding to stride size, terrain, and tempo.

Although the main goal in coaching to walk a marathon is to extend strolling distance, you’ll nonetheless wish to improve your total fitness. Walking a marathon with out coaching, whereas attainable, will likely require considerably longer restoration than if you had skilled. Taking the time to increase your weekly walking mileage in addition to building total health will assist put together you for fulfillment with a walking marathon.
